How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Philadelphia County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Philadelphia County Studio Apartments | $1,684 | $502 | $6,238 |
| Philadelphia County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,071 | $539 | $10,000+ |
| Philadelphia County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,529 | $499 | $10,000+ |
| Philadelphia County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,875 | $730 | $10,000+ |
| Philadelphia County 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,949 | $560 | $10,000+ |
| Philadelphia County 5 Bedroom Apartments | $2,780 | $2,140 | $5,000 |
| Philadelphia County 6 Bedroom Apartments | $2,425 | $525 | $3,810 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Short-term Philadelphia County Apartments
What is the Cheapest Short-term apartment in Philadelphia County?
Currently the most affordable Short-term Apartment in Philadelphia County is at Temple Nest Apartments listed at $599.
How much is the average rent for a Short-term Philadelphia County Apartment?
The average rent for a Short-term Apartment in Philadelphia County is $2,664.
What is the largest Short-term Philadelphia County Apartment for rent?
Today's Short-term apartment with the most square footage in Philadelphia County is a 7,534 square feet unit starting from $5,052 at 219 Vine St.
What is the average size for Philadelphia County Short-term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Short-term rental in Philadelphia County is currently at 708 sq ft.
